Seaway Dike | Installation of a safety corridor for pedestrians and cyclists under the original Champlain Bridge on August 2
July 29, 2021 Active mobility Champlain Deconstruction

JCCBI would like to inform active mobility users that a safety corridor will be set up on the seaway dike over the next six months (August 2021 to January 2022) in anticipation of preparatory work at an elevated height for the deconstruction of the steel structure of the Champlain Bridge.

  • Cyclists must dismount from their bikes to safely travel through the corridor.
  • Flaggers will be on site while the corridor is being set up, and appropriate signage will be put in place once the corridor is in service.
